Keeping Safe When Riding Your Electric Scooter

Riding an electric scooter requires vigilance and awareness to guarantee safety on bustling city streets. Cyclists should always wear a helmet, as this considerably reduces the risk of head injuries in case of accidents. It is important to become acquainted with local traffic laws, as regulations can vary widely by city. Maintaining a safe speed and staying at a proper distance from vehicles and pedestrians promotes overall safety.

Additionally, riders should remain alert to common road risks like potholes, debris, and sudden obstacles. Using hand signals when turning or stopping can also communicate intentions to others on the road. Riding at night requires reflective gear or lights to improve visibility. Lastly, steering clear of distractions such as smartphones encourages attentive riding. By following these safety guidelines, users of electric scooters can experience a more secure and conscientious ride while traversing urban environments.

Frequently Asked Questions

How Do Electric Scooters Compare to Bikes in Urban Settings?

Electric scooters commonly deliver speedier, more streamlined commuting options than bicycles, perfect for brief journeys. However, bikes provide greater physical activity and stability. Ultimately, the choice depends on unique lifestyle choices and distinct metropolitan conditions.

What Financial Costs Come With Owning an Electric Scooter?

Having an electric scooter involves initial purchase costs, upkeep costs, coverage costs, and potential charging costs. Moreover, owners may face storage charges and demand supplementary gear, each adding to the complete cost of owning one.

Are Electric Scooters Suitable for All Age Groups?

Electric scooters are typically appropriate for a wide range of age groups, as long as riders follow established safety guidelines. Nevertheless, younger riders may benefit from parental supervision, whereas older adults should take into account their physical abilities and ease with balancing and steering.

How Does Weather Affect Electric Scooter Usage?

Weather plays a significant role in electric scooter ridership. Adverse conditions including rain, snow, and temperature extremes deter riders due to safety concerns and discomfort, while mild, dry weather promotes more regular ridership, enhancing overall rider experience and accessibility.

Which Regulations Control Electric Scooter Riding in Urban Areas?

Policies regulating electric scooter usage across municipalities commonly encompass helmet requirements, insurance mandates, speed limits, age restrictions, and designated parking areas. These policies work to promote safer travel, alleviate urban congestion, and embed scooters within established transportation networks.
